Output 58c32bf3166a9de87a89ba185505350b4cfd538697125956c8138942ae5f32e6:1

value
714525
script pubkey
OP_0 OP_PUSHBYTES_20 b11139a1096f8f5145e5a6e6a363910940010104
address
bc1qkygnnggfd784z3095mn2xcu3p9qqzqgy786swu
transaction
58c32bf3166a9de87a89ba185505350b4cfd538697125956c8138942ae5f32e6